From bd068d6a9a84d1e52b798717fc6e541cfda97457 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 17:13:53 +0200 Subject: [PATCH 01/10] renovate!! --- renovate.json5 | 30 ++++++++++++++---------------- 1 file changed, 14 insertions(+), 16 deletions(-) diff --git a/renovate.json5 b/renovate.json5 index 9ef76251627cc..0d9c501c4b491 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-10,17 +10,11 @@ ":disablePeerDependencies", ":maintainLockFilesDisabled", ":disableRateLimiting", + ":label(maintenance)", + ":ignoreModulesAndTests", + "schedule:weekdays", ], includePaths: ["package.json", "packages/**", "starters/**", "examples/**"], - ignorePaths: [ - "**/node_modules/**", - "**/bower_components/**", - "**/vendor/**", - "**/__tests__/**", - "**/test/**", - "**/tests/**", - "**/__fixtures__/**", - ], major: { dependencyDashboardApproval: true, }, @@ -32,19 +26,24 @@ prHourlyLimit: 0, // Wait for 3 days to update a package so we can check if it's stable stabilityDays: 3, + postUpdateOptions: ["yarnDedupeHighest"], packageRules: [ - // these rules define group names - { - groupName: "packages", - paths: ["package.json", "packages/**"], - }, { groupName: "starters and examples", paths: ["starters/**", "examples/**"], + schedule: "before 3am on Monday", + }, + { + groupName: "starters and examples - Gatsby", + extends: ["starters and examples"], + packagePatterns: ["^gatsby-", "gatsby"], + schedule: "at any time", + automerge: true, + stabilityDays: 0, }, { groupName: "babel monorepo", - sourceUrlPrefixes: "https://github.com/babel/babel", + sourceUrlPrefixes: ["https://github.com/babel/babel"], }, { groupName: "dev dependencies", @@ -171,5 +170,4 @@ }, ], timezone: "GMT", - schedule: "after 10am on Monday", } From 17049354c2c112e5b838195dd77b46543e08eec8 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 17:16:15 +0200 Subject: [PATCH 02/10] renovate!! --- renovate.json5 |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/renovate.json5 b/renovate.json5 index 0d9c501c4b491..847e6cbf02089 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-35,7 +35,7 @@ }, { groupName: "starters and examples - Gatsby", - extends: ["starters and examples"], + paths: ["starters/**", "examples/**"], packagePatterns: ["^gatsby-", "gatsby"], schedule: "at any time", automerge: true, From 548cf36083399dfcade5a460b8534a4d9b50f640 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 17:55:59 +0200 Subject: [PATCH 03/10] tmp --- renovate.json5 |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/renovate.json5 b/renovate.json5 index 847e6cbf02089..02b448b4cebac 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-34,9 +34,9 @@ schedule: "before 3am on Monday", }, { + extends: ["monorepo:gatsby"], groupName: "starters and examples - Gatsby", paths: ["starters/**", "examples/**"], - packagePatterns: ["^gatsby-", "gatsby"], schedule: "at any time", automerge: true, stabilityDays: 0, @@ -46,9 +46,13 @@ sourceUrlPrefixes: ["https://github.com/babel/babel"], }, { - groupName: "dev dependencies", - depTypeList: ["devDependencies"], + groupName: "mdx", + sourceUrlPrefixes: ["https://github.com/mdx-js/mdx"], }, + //{ + // groupName: "dev dependencies", + // depTypeList: ["devDependencies"], + //}, // these rules define dependencies that we have special handling for { packageNames: ["gatsby-interface"], @@ -91,7 +95,7 @@ { // minor updates in packages <1.0.0 - need master issue approval // not grouped - groupName: "packages (<1.0.0 minor)", + // groupName: "packages (<1.0.0 minor)", paths: ["package.json", "packages/**"], dependencyDashboardApproval: true, updateTypes: ["minor"], From e530215f71056104b4c742c9deb22aef5ac603d6 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 20:39:18 +0200 Subject: [PATCH 04/10] tmp --- renovate.json5 | 1 + 1 file changed, 1 insertion(+) diff --git a/renovate.json5 b/renovate.json5 index 02b448b4cebac..69c4ba796fa92 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-48,6 +48,7 @@ { groupName: "mdx", sourceUrlPrefixes: ["https://github.com/mdx-js/mdx"], + updateTypes: ["major", "minor", "patch"], }, //{ // groupName: "dev dependencies", From e2289258355c98e6b8d5292a93ab294719793945 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 21:39:05 +0200 Subject: [PATCH 05/10] tmp --- renovate.json5 |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/renovate.json5 b/renovate.json5 index 69c4ba796fa92..8c9fdb12bd133 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-45,6 +45,10 @@ groupName: "babel monorepo", sourceUrlPrefixes: ["https://github.com/babel/babel"], }, + { + groupName: "lodash monorepo", + sourceUrlPrefixes: ["https://github.com/lodash/"], + }, { groupName: "mdx", sourceUrlPrefixes: ["https://github.com/mdx-js/mdx"], From 890de97c86b18df3c2723cfb4f41bf27350e48ea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 21:42:18 +0200 Subject: [PATCH 06/10] update --- renovate.json5 |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/renovate.json5 b/renovate.json5 index 8c9fdb12bd133..fa0a1e9c4adb9 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-12,7 +12,7 @@ ":disableRateLimiting", ":label(maintenance)", ":ignoreModulesAndTests", - "schedule:weekdays", + // "schedule:weekdays", ], includePaths: ["package.json", "packages/**", "starters/**", "examples/**"], major: { From 69b42cb6afa25f2d09229244de0b72af92156f23 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 22:27:57 +0200 Subject: [PATCH 07/10] test --- renovate.json5 |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/renovate.json5 b/renovate.json5 index fa0a1e9c4adb9..c370e11635a6f 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-40,6 +40,7 @@ schedule: "at any time", automerge: true, stabilityDays: 0, + prPriority: 50, }, { groupName: "babel monorepo", @@ -179,4 +180,7 @@ }, ], timezone: "GMT", + vulnerabilityAlerts: { + assignees: ["@wardpeet"], + }, } From 997cae33631b3383cc58fe66c9e4b5dd944270ce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Wed, 23 Sep 2020 22:41:14 +0200 Subject: [PATCH 08/10] test --- renovate.json5 |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/renovate.json5 b/renovate.json5 index c370e11635a6f..acd44b1bc924a 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-27,6 +27,8 @@ // Wait for 3 days to update a package so we can check if it's stable stabilityDays: 3, postUpdateOptions: ["yarnDedupeHighest"], + timezone: "GMT", + schedule: "at any time", packageRules: [ { groupName: "starters and examples", @@ -37,7 +39,6 @@ extends: ["monorepo:gatsby"], groupName: "starters and examples - Gatsby", paths: ["starters/**", "examples/**"], - schedule: "at any time", automerge: true, stabilityDays: 0, prPriority: 50, @@ -179,7 +180,6 @@ dependencyDashboardApproval: true, }, ], - timezone: "GMT", vulnerabilityAlerts: { assignees: ["@wardpeet"], }, From 757372b838d2918c6930b3bdf2afd4f13bf8b125 Mon Sep 17 00:00:00 2001 From: Ward Peeters Date: Thu, 24 Sep 2020 08:34:37 +0200 Subject: [PATCH 09/10] renovate --- renovate.json5 |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/renovate.json5 b/renovate.json5 index acd44b1bc924a..b4369a368c57b 100644 --- a/renovate.json5 +++ b/renovate.json5 @@ -52,10 +52,14 @@ sourceUrlPrefixes: ["https://github.com/lodash/"], }, { - groupName: "mdx", + groupName: "mdx monorepo", sourceUrlPrefixes: ["https://github.com/mdx-js/mdx"], updateTypes: ["major", "minor", "patch"], }, + { + groupName: "Gatsby Core dependencies", + paths: ["packages/gatsby/package.json"], + }, //{ // groupName: "dev dependencies", // depTypeList: ["devDependencies"], From 0c9f850e9bbe4c34f6e91453640859386162b499 Mon Sep 17 00:00:00 2001 From: Renovate Bot Date: Thu, 24 Sep 2020 08:37:34 +0000 Subject: [PATCH 10/10] chore: update dependency aws-sdk to ^2.759.0 --- packages/gatsby-transformer-screenshot/lambda/package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/gatsby-transformer-screenshot/lambda/package.json b/packages/gatsby-transformer-screenshot/lambda/package.json index cc5046fe20873..65750d55337d2 100644 --- a/packages/gatsby-transformer-screenshot/lambda/package.json +++ b/packages/gatsby-transformer-screenshot/lambda/package.json @@ -5,7 +5,7 @@ "puppeteer-core": "^3.3.0" }, "devDependencies": { - "aws-sdk": "^2.707.0" + "aws-sdk": "^2.759.0" }, "keywords": [], "engines": {